S. W. FLA. WINTER VEG. GROWERS ASS'N v. U. S.

C.D. 4845; Court No. 80-1-00019.

484 F.Supp. 910 (1980)

SOUTHWEST FLORIDA WINTER VEGETABLE GROWERS ASSOCIATION et al., Plaintiffs, v. UNITED STATES, Defendant.

United States Customs Court.

February 27,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Van Ness, Feldman & Sutcliffe, Washington, D. C. (Gerry Levenberg, Washington, D. C., on the brief), for plaintiffs.

Alice Daniel, Acting Asst. Atty. Gen. (David M. Cohen, Director, Commercial Litigation Branch, Washington, D. C., on the briefs), for defendant.

Arnold & Porter, Washington, D. C. (Alexander E. Bennett, Brooksley E. Landau, and Enid L. Veron, Washington, D. C., on the brief), for intervenor West Mexico Vegetable Distributors Assn.


On Defendant's Motion to Dismiss

MALETZ, Judge.

The question to be decided is whether in an action filed after January 1, 1980, this court has jurisdiction under the Trade Agreements Act of 1979 (hereafter TAA) to review a preliminary determination of sales at not less than fair value that was made by the Secretary of the Treasury prior to January 1, 1980, the effective date of the TAA.
